Treaty in the spirit of naturalism, the portrait represents Adolphe Alphand (1817-1891) in his functions during the installation of the Universal Exhibition in 1889, one of the last major projects of his long and active carrière.On guess in the background the dome of the Invalides, which side will soon climb the Tower of Gustave Eiffel completed in March 1889.
